How to Eat Beets

Two ways to eat

1. Cold salad:

This is the simplest and most common way to eat beets. It not only ensures the original flavor of beets, but also has rich nutritional value. The specific method is to wash the beet roots with clean water and then peel them. Cut the peeled beets into shreds, being careful not to cut them too thick or too thin. It would be even better if you have a special shredding tool at home. Place the shredded beets in a container large enough to facilitate mixing. You can also put some fruits in it, add appropriate amount of vinegar, olive oil and other seasonings, stir well and then you can eat it.

2. Fried tofu:

Beet scramble with tofu is a low-fat recipe that can be used as a fitness meal. If you are trying to lose weight, you might as well try this way of eating. It contains very little oil, but is very nutritious and you won’t feel hungry after eating it. Combined with reasonable fitness methods, you can quickly achieve the weight loss effect you expect. The specific method is to peel the beets, cut them into pieces, and cook them first. At the same time, cut the tofu into cubes and use some common seasonings as the ingredients. Heat a pan with a little oil, stir-fry the beets over medium heat for about half a minute, then add tofu, peas, etc. and stir-fry. After the side dishes are ready, just add the seasoning and it’s done. The effect will be better if you add chili powder or other condiments that help burn fat!

Tips for eating

1. Just like pH test paper, it will turn purple in an alkaline environment, which does not mean it is broken.

2. Acidic condiments such as vinegar can keep the beets fresh in color.

3. Add all seasoning salt last.

4. You can also heat it in the oven to make it taste better.
